#9d4691 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9d4691 is composed of 61.6% red, 27.5%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.4% magenta, 7.6%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 308.3 degrees, a saturation of 38.3% and a lightness of 44.5%. #9d4691 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cff with #3b0023.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#9d4691 color description : Dark moderate magenta.

#9d4691 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9d4691 has RGB values of R:157, G:70,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.08,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10307217.

Shades and Tints of #9d4691

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080307 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9d4691

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a6978 is the less saturated color, while #e300c4 is the most saturated one.
